If your stock is currently at $70, they’ll say things like “I’m a buyer at $50.” This causes you to question your investment thesis. Did you get in too early? Is bad news about to drop?
Your brain becomes attached to the 50 number. There’s science to prove it. You can even test it with your friends. Ask one friend if he thinks Abraham Lincoln was older or younger than 50 when he died. Then ask that same friend at exactly what age do they think Lincoln died. Odds are they’ll give a number around 50 due to the anchoring effect.
Now, ask a second friend the same set of questions, but change the age from 50 to 100.Odds are the second friend will give a number closer to 100'.
